Join TYJP at the North Carolina Zoo in
Asheboro! Spend the day walking through the Zoo enjoying the animals.
This is a much anticipated TYJP event.
There are currently several special exhibits at the zoo, including the Australian Walkabout, where
you can visit an abandoned outback cattle station that is now home to
kangaroos, wallabies, emus, parrots, pythons, and lizards. See colorful
birds, snakes, and frogs from Australia's forests. You can also see SimEx Reactor “Dino Island II
3-D”, where a volcanic eruption threatens life on Dino Island. An
effort is under way to save from extinction “Tony” the only surviving
male T-Rex in the world. The 3-D effects will thrill you. Great fun for
the whole family! (This is an additional $3 per person). For more
information on the Zoo’s exhibits go to www.nczoo.org.
Driving from Raleigh to the Zoo takes approximately 1.5 - 2 hours. We
can enjoy lunch at the zoo and then have at dinner at Friendly’s on the
way home. Admission to the zoo is $10.
